VS1003CN:MP3/WMA解码芯片技术详解

需积分: 10 0 下载量 201 浏览量 更新于2024-09-26 收藏 836KB PDF 举报
"VS1003cn是一款MP3/WMA音频解码芯片,具备多种音频格式支持,如MPEG1、MPEG2音频层III、WMA、WAV等。该芯片集成了IMA ADPCM编码功能,适用于麦克风或线路输入的音频信号处理。VS1003支持高低音控制,并能在单个12到13MHz时钟下运行,具有内部PLL锁相环时钟倍频器,确保低功耗和高效性能。芯片内含高性能的立体声数模转换器和耳机驱动器,能够直接驱动30欧姆负载,且模拟、数字和I/O部分可以独立供电。此外,它还配备了5.5KB的片上RAM用于用户代码和数据,以及SPI Flash引导和UART接口,方便特殊应用和调试。VS_DSP4处理器核使得VS1003可以执行额外的用户定义功能,通过4个GPIO进行扩展。该芯片的工作电压范围和温度范围都经过优化,确保在各种环境下稳定工作。" VS1003的主要特点包括: 1. **多格式解码能力**:VS1003支持MPEG1和MPEG2音频层III(CBR、VBR、ABR),WMA4.0/4.1/7/8/9,以及WAV(PCM和IMA ADPCM)格式的音频解码,还包括MIDI和SP-MIDI文件的处理。 2. **音频编码功能**:芯片内置了IMA ADPCM编码器,可以对麦克风或线路输入的音频信号进行编码处理。 3. **串行接口与兼容性**:VS1003通过串行接口接收比特流,可以作为系统中的从设备,与主控器进行通信。它支持SPI和UART接口,便于与其他设备集成。 4. **音频处理硬件**:内含高性能的DSP处理器核心VS_DSP4,5KB的指令RAM和0.5KB的数据RAM,为用户应用提供了扩展空间。同时,芯片内置了18位过采样多位ε-Δ DAC,确保高质量的音频输出。 5. **电源管理**:VS1003有独立的模拟电源(AVDD)、数字电源(CVDD)和I/O电源(IOVDD),允许在不同电压范围内工作,降低了对电源的需求。 6. **低功耗设计**:单时钟操作和内部PLL锁相环时钟倍频器有助于减少功耗。 7. **硬件支持**:内置立体声数模转换器(DAC)和耳机驱动器,可直接驱动30欧姆负载的扬声器,无需额外的音频放大电路。 8. **GPIO扩展**:4个通用输入/输出口(GPIO)允许通过软件扩展功能,增强了芯片的灵活性。 VS1003的操作参数和建议操作环境也进行了详细说明,包括电源电压、输入/输出电流和电压限制,以及工作和存储温度范围。这些参数确保了芯片在不同环境下的正常工作。 VS1003cn是一款高度集成的音频解码芯片,适用于各种音频播放设备和嵌入式系统,如便携式音乐播放器、智能家居设备、汽车音响等,通过其丰富的功能和灵活的接口,能够满足不同应用场景的需求。